It's really cheap compared to commercial soil. For what's pictured: compost: 17$, perlite: 20$, peat: 12$

The rest if you buy those giant bags of materials.. well you do the math :P There's a massive difference in returns if you buy a 44lb bag vs a 1lb bag on amazon.

I'd argue that since this soil lasts at least a harvest or two (longer if you no-till) it's probably 4x-8x cheaper than roots or fox farms.
